Livestock drive at the stockyards Image Copyright: Anietra HamperFamed livestock drive via the roads in the National Stockyards Area that happens twice a day Established in 1866, Fort Worth Stockyards National Historic Area owes its popularity and unique character to the cattle sector. The last huge stop on the Chisholm Trail and the last staying historical stockyard in the USA it as soon as saw numerous livestock go through.


A browse through takes site visitors back to the days of the great cattle summaries, with all sort of associated enjoyment and fun things to see and do, from rodeos to live songs programs, museums, and western-themed shopping. The centerpiece at the stockyards occurs at 11:30 am and 4pm everyday, when spectators line the streets to see the livestock drive of the Fort Well Worth Longhorn Herd along the major road.

Address: 201 Main Street # 700, Ft Well Worth, Texas Fort Worth Water Gardens Terraced Active Swimming pool with 360-degree plunging waterfalls in a geometric layout Located in downtown Fort Well worth, beside the Convention Center, the Water Gardens are much more than merely a collection of rather water fountains to gaze at.


Constructed in 1974, the Water Gardens function three pools set amid a vast 4 - Fort Worth address.3-acre park. The biggest of these water functions, the "active pool" is a 38-foot-tall terraced area that is made use of by waders as steps while the water moves throughout the stone and into a main swimming pool. The "aerating swimming pool" is a collection of water fountains that rests under the color of towering oak trees, especially lovely in the evening when it is lit up

Established in 1934 and the oldest such center in Texas, it is home to 3,500 types of plants outlined in 23 special yards. Highlights consist of the Scent Garden, the Rose Yard, and the Rain forest Sunroom. Among the most prominent areas is the idyllic Japanese Yard, a peaceful 7.5 acres of magnolias, cherry trees, bamboo, and other conventional vegetation, with wonderful paths that curve over footbridges and previous ponds filled with koi.




The facility additionally has several various other conservation and sustainability jobs underway. There's also on-site eating with garden-view patio area seats.

The spring months are colorful and fragrant with flowers in bloom, and lots of celebrations happening around the city. The autumn months of September, October, and November are additionally comfy times to see Ft Worth. Ordinary daytime temperature levels in September and October array in the high-70s to mid-80s Fahrenheit. Temperature levels go down even more by November, averaging in the mid-to-high 60s, which is comfortable for going to regional sites.


It is best to stay clear of the months of June, July, and August when summer temperatures in Fort Well worth are regularly in the 90s Fahrenheit with stifling humidity.
